Paul Pogba has rejoined Juventus on a four-year contract, the club has announced, following his exit from Manchester United as a free agent last month.
The France international enjoyed a successful first stint at the club between 2012 and 2016, winning Serie A four times in a row and and the Coppa Italia twice.
“I am back, I am here and I can’t wait to get started,” Pogba told the club’s Twitter account.”I am very, very happy. “I can’t wait to get started and wear this Juventus jersey again.”
